Transaction 43d24d3a793642257677a2c253018e8232cc050704a9cfe3062d4851d577205d

1 Input
2 Outputs
  • 43d24d3a793642257677a2c253018e8232cc050704a9cfe3062d4851d577205d:0
  • value  13520
    address  3Bk32ER1YGsEDJY8YL8Svt9zDSVcU8YViU
  • 43d24d3a793642257677a2c253018e8232cc050704a9cfe3062d4851d577205d:1
  • value  15844
    address  15zdnDG2FnNmoDBgskFkmwSs8HvKyYZSLL